Get PriceTesla specialists are on the ground assisting Samoa’s electric power corporation engineers to ensure its battery energy storage systems are operating to support Samoa’s energy needs during the current power crisis. Image: Electric Power Corporation, Samoa
The American Samoa Power Authority selected Eastern Power Solutions with the EVLO 1000 BESS to enhance the delivery of safe, reliable, and clean power to the local community. ASPA is a development-oriented public utility providing electricity, water, wastewater, and solid waste services to about 50,000 residents.
The crisis has led to up to 16 hours of daily power interruptions across Upolu requiring extensive power rationing coordinated by the Electric Power Corporation (EPC). Samoan Prime Minister Fiame Naomi Mata’afa said the economic impact of the crisis is estimated to cost up to 16% of Samoa’s GDP.
